Sarasota, FL is a cultural gem. Once home to the Ringling Brothers Circus, Sarasota boasts a rich arts scene that brings people from all over the area to enjoy world-class theater, music, and other performing arts. Sarasota is also a haven with spectacular scenery, turquoise water and white sandy beaches. It offers a delightful downtown with a variety of small boutiques and exceptional restaurants. With its dynamic culture and arts scene and incredible natural beauty, Sarasota is a wonderful place to call “home.”
